I do not think that there is any reason for using over engineered platforms
like Petastorm and Ray, except for certain use cases.

What Ray is doing, except for certain use cases, could have been easily
done by SPARK, I think, had the open source community got that steer. But
maybe I am wrong and someone should be able to explain why the SPARK open
source community cannot develop the capabilities which are so natural to
almost all use cases of data processing in SPARK where the data gets
consumed by deep learning frameworks and we are asked to use Ray or
Petastorm?

For those of us who are asking what does native integrations means please
try to compare delta between release 2.x and 3.x and koalas before 3.2 and
after 3.2.

I am sure that the SPARK community can push for extending the dataframes
from SPARK to deep learning and other frameworks by natively integrating
them.

>> I am using Spark3.0+ version with Tensorflow 2.0+.
>>
>> My use case is not for the image data but for the Time-series data where
>> I am using LSTM and transformers to forecast.
>>
>>
>>
>> I evaluated *SparkFlow* and *spark_tensorflow_distributor *libraries, and
>> there has been no major development recently on those libraries. I faced
>> the issue of version dependencies on those and had a hard time fixing the
>> library compatibilities. Hence a couple of below doubts:-
>>
>>
>>
>>    - Does *Horovod* have any dependencies?
>>    - Any other library which is suitable for my use case.?
>>    - Any example code would really be of great help to understand.
